Character sketch of Skyresh Bolgolam
High Admiral of Lilliput and counselor to the Emperor, Skyresh Bolgolam is the enemy of Gulliver from the start. He is afraid to loose his position as the counselor to the king. Gulliver's advancement would mean his loss of importance in King's eyes. Thus he brings Gulliver a list of demands or conditions for Gulliver to stay in Lilliput, as it is favorable to his promotion in the court, later he teams up with Flimnap to draw up articles of impeachment, which are leaked to Gulliver by an unnamed member of the court.

Reldresal was the principal secretary of private affairs in Lilliput, and was also a good friend of Gulliver. When the other officials, plot to kill Gulliver, it was him who tried to convince the king to spare Gulliver's life and show some leniency. He also informed Gulliver of the plot against him and hence Gulliver was able to make a swift escape to Blefuscu and save his life.
